The Virginia Cavaliers (8-5) will battle the Clemson Tigers (9-4) in the ACC at Littlejohn Coliseum in Clemson on Tuesday at 9:00 PM ET. Virginia has issues in consistency of their play but managed to win eight of their first 13 outings this season. The Cavaliers won three of their last contests played including their recent win versus the Syracuse Orange on New Year’s Day.

 

Virginia is in 5th place at 2-1 in the Atlantic Coast Conference with an overall standing at 8-5 while winning just one of their last three road contests this season.

 

The tough defense of the Cavaliers keyed their victory after holding Syracuse to just 36.7% field goal shooting and pushed them to commit 11 turnovers in the victory. Guards Kihei Clark and Armaan Franklin led the offense with 17 points each while Forward Jayden Gardner chipped in 15 points.

 

Virginia outmatched Syracuse in overall shooting by 52.6% (30/57) to 36.7% (22/60), converted 35.0% (7/20) of their attempts from the three-point range, and connected 70.0% (7/10) of their free-throw attempts.

 

The Cavaliers grabbed 33 total rebounds with 9 coming from the offensive side of the court while distributing 22 assists in the win. The defense for Virginia blocked 5 attempted shots while stealing the ball 8 times but committed 9 turnovers and 17 personal fouls.

Virginia Cavaliers vs Clemson Tigers Predictions 1/4/2022

 

The Clemson Tigers started the season with a four-game winning streak but lost to St. Bonaventure, West Virginia, Rutgers, and Miami-FL in the next five contests played. However, the Tigers ended up winning their last four outings versus Drake, Miami-OH, South Carolina, and the Virginia Cavaliers in that order.

 

Clemson occupied 6th place at 1-1 behind Virginia in the Atlantic Coast Conference with a 9-4 overall standing while winning all 6 matches played at home this season. The Tigers’ defense held the offense of the Cavaliers to just 36.6% shooting from the field on the way to their 67-50 blowout win on December 22.

 

Forward Hunter Tyson led the way for Clemson with 17 points while Guard David Collins and Forward PJ Hall pitched in 11 points each in the win. Collins added 11 rebounds to complete his double-double statistics.

 

Clemson completed 28 of 59 (47.5%) shooting from the field, connected 8 of 22 (36.4%) attempted shots from the long-range, and made 3 of 8 (37.5%) tries from the charity stripe.

 

The Tigers pulled down 27 defensive boards and hauled down 8 offensive rebounds with 12 assists in the match. The Clemson Tigers blocked one shot with 7 steals but lost the leather in 7 turnovers while committing 17 personal fouls in the contest.
